Temporary_add_to_version_control
标题“Temporary_add_to_version_control”暗示了我们正在讨论与版本控制系统相关的临时操作,可能是关于如何在开发过程中暂时将文件添加到版本控制中的方法。在这个场景下,版本控制系统(如Git)是开发者用来跟踪代码更改、协作和管理项目的重要工具。 在软件开发中,版本控制系统允许程序员保存每个修改的历史记录,以便于回滚到之前的版本、比较不同版本之间的差异,并协同工作。当一个新项目开始或开发者在现有项目中引入新的功能时,通常会将所有相关文件添加到版本控制中。然而,有时可能需要暂时将某些文件加入版本控制,例如为了调试、测试或者与其他团队成员共享。 描述虽然没有提供具体信息,但我们可以推测这是关于在特定情况下如何临时性地处理版本控制的指导。这可能包括如何在不永久性地提交到主分支的情况下,将文件添加到暂存区,或者如何创建一个临时分支来处理某个特定问题。 在Git中,`git add`命令用于将更改添加到暂存区,准备进行提交。如果要临时添加一个文件,可以使用`git add <file>`命令。如果你想在一次提交中只包含一部分更改,可以使用`git add -p`来交互式地选择要暂存的改动块。 标签为空,意味着没有特定的主题标签来指导更具体的讨论。因此,我们可以扩展到版本控制系统的其他方面,比如: 1. **分支管理**:在Git中,分支允许开发人员在不影响主分支(通常是`master`或`main`)的情况下进行实验性更改。可以创建一个临时分支,如`temp-feature`,在该分支上工作,完成后合并回主分支。 2. **忽略文件**:如果你不想让某些文件进入版本控制,可以在根目录下创建`.gitignore`文件,列出这些文件的模式。这样,即使它们在工作目录中,也不会被意外地提交。 3. **提交消息**:每次提交时都应提供有意义的提交消息,以便团队成员理解所做的更改。对于临时提交,你可能想在消息中注明这是临时性的。 4. **撤销更改**:如果添加了不应该被版本化的文件,可以使用`git reset`或`git checkout`命令来撤销。 5. **拉取请求(Pull Request)**:在协作环境中,通常会通过拉取请求来审查和合并代码。你可以创建一个临时的拉取请求来讨论或测试你的更改,而不立即合并到主分支。 6. **代码审查**:在大型项目中,可能有代码审查流程,临时提交可以帮助团队成员在正式合并前检查代码。 "Temporary_add_to_version_control"主题涵盖了如何有效地在版本控制系统中管理临时性的更改和文件,以保持项目的整洁和协作的顺畅。了解并熟练运用这些技巧对于任何开发者来说都是至关重要的。
- 1
- 粉丝: 32
- 资源: 4604
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助